Gold futures down on weak global cues

Globally, gold traded at USD 1,192.21 an ounce in Singapore from USD 1,193.94 yesterday


At the Multi Commodity Exchange, gold for delivery in June contracts eased by Rs 67, or 0.25 percent, to Rs 27,100 per 10 gram in business turnover of 366 lots.

Likewise, the metal for delivery in far-month August shed Rs 65, or 0.24 percent, to Rs 27,346 per 10 gram in nine lots.

Market analysts said a weak trend in the overseas markets, kept pressure on gold prices in futures trade here.
